University of Oklahoma Health Sciences Center is Hiring a Laboratory Technician Near Oklahoma, OK

The University of Oklahoma Health Sciences Center in Oklahoma City has an opening for a full-time Research Technician.

We are seeking a highly motivated and organized individual to join a collaborative and multidisciplinary team of scientists and clinicians focused on newborn health and disease research. The candidate will join a lab using state-of-the-art technologies and experimental animal and cell models to identify molecular influences of bronchopulmonary dysplasia in infants. The research technician will support the team by conducting research experiments, collecting data and samples, keeping records, maintaining lab organization, conducting literature searches, analyzing data, and preparing reports.

Requirements: Bachelor’s Degree in Biological Sciences, Chemistry, Physics, or other health-related field. Will accept 48 months equivalent experience in lieu of the Bachelor’s Degree.

Skills: Knowledge of foundational biology concepts; knowledge of laboratory procedures; knowledge of the proper handling of chemicals and biohazardous materials; ability to perform mathematical calculations in different units of measurement; kn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ite or other relevant programs; detail-oriented and excellent organizational skills; and ability to communicate verbally and in writing.

Preferences: Team player with strong interpersonal and communication skills; detail-oriented, highly organized and meticulous to ensure accuracy of data collection and recording; and willingness to learn new techniques, analysis methods and initiative to solve problems; knowledge of graphical software and statistical approaches.

Salary: Targeted salary at $38,000 annually based on experience excellent benefits
